• Regularly take off the cover and remove dust with an air gun. Take
the opportunity to have a qualified person check the electrical
connections with an insulated tool.
• Under no circumstances should solvents or other aggressive
cleaning agents be used.
• Clean the device's surfaces with a soft, dry cloth.

G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The START range is designed to charge and start lead-acid batteries, 12V (6 elements) and 24V (12 elements) :
Start 200
Start 300
POWER SUPPLY
Check that the power supply and its protection (fuse and/or circuit breaker) are compatible with the current needed by
the machine. The device must be positioned so that the socket is always accessible.
The machine must be connected to a single phase socket (230 V) WITH earth protected by a 16A circuit breaker.
CONNECTION AND DISCONNECTION
IMPORTANT ! Before any connection to a vehicle battery, make sure that the booster isn't connected to the mains and
that the booster's switch is set to OFF. Also, check the battery polarity.
Warning : the cables must not be kinked or in contact with hot or sharp surfaces.
• Disconnect any electronic system from the battery during the charge (do not charge the battery when it's connectd
to the vehicle).
